Technical Specifications & Compatibility
Forged 6061-T6 Billet Aluminum Construction
These spacers are crafted using CNC precision machining from high-quality aluminum alloy. I’ve found that this material provides the perfect balance of lightweight performance and the heavy-duty strength required for ram 2500 wheel spacers, ensuring they don’t crack under the pressure of heavy loads.
High-Tensile Grade 12.9 Studs
Safety is paramount when modifying a suspension. These units feature Grade 12.9 studs with a 1000MPa tensile strength, which is significantly stronger than the standard 10.9 studs found in cheaper alternatives. In my testing, this provides much better structural support during sharp turns.
Protective Anodized Surface
The metal surface is treated with an anodized coating to prevent environmental erosion. This extra layer effectively protects the spacers from rust and road salt, which is crucial if you live in a climate with harsh winters or frequently drive in muddy conditions.
Precision 126.15mm Center Bore
The 126.15mm center bore ensures a proper fit for a wide variety of 8-lug vehicles. Beyond the 2013-2024 Ram 2500, they also fit older Silverado 2500/3500 HD models and various Express vans, making them a versatile choice for heavy-duty fleet owners or enthusiasts.

Real-World Performance and Safety Analysis

Daily Highway Commuting
When I tested these Richeer 2 inch 8×6.5 Wheel Spacers on a 2018 Ram 2500, the first thing I noticed was the significantly wider track. On the highway, the truck felt more planted during lane changes. However, I did experience a minor steering wheel shimmy at speeds exceeding 75 mph, which likely contributes to the 3.8-star rating. It isn’t a dealbreaker, but it reminds you that budget spacers require meticulous balancing.
Heavy Towing Scenarios
Safety is paramount when hauling, so I hitched a 10,000-pound flatbed to see how the forged 6061-T6 aluminum handled the stress. The spacers remained rock solid. I didn’t detect any lug nut loosening after a 50-mile haul, suggesting the 14×1.5 studs are high-quality grade 12.9 steel as advertised. For those using ram 2500 wheel spacers for work, these provide the clearance needed for beefier tires without compromising vertical load capacity.
Off-Road Articulation
Navigating rocky trails showed the true benefit of the 2-inch offset. By pushing the wheels out, I completely eliminated the tire rub on the control arms during full-lock turns. The 126.15mm center bore fits snugly, but you must ensure your hub surface is wire-brushed clean to prevent the “wobble” many entry-level users complain about.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Do these ram 2500 wheel spacers require trimming my factory studs?
Yes, because these are 2-inch spacers, if your factory studs are longer than 2 inches, you may need to trim them or use wheels with deep pockets to ensure the wheel sits flush against the spacer.
Are these spacers hub-centric or lug-centric?
These are designed with a 126.15mm center bore to be hub-centric for specific Chevy and Ram models, which helps reduce vibration by centering the weight on the hub rather than just the lugs.
What is the torque specification for installation?
You should torque the spacer-to-hub nuts to 130-140 ft-lbs, and then re-torque your wheel-to-spacer nuts to the same spec after the first 50 miles.
Will these ram 2500 wheel spacers affect my fuel economy?
Slightly. Increasing the width of your vehicle increases aerodynamic drag, and the added weight of the aluminum can marginally impact MPG, though the difference is usually negligible.
Can I use an impact wrench for installation?
No. Using an impact wrench can over-stretch the studs or lead to uneven seating. Always use a calibrated torque wrench for safety.
Do these fit the Ram 3500 Dually?
No, these are intended for single rear wheel (SRW) configurations with the 8×6.5 (8×165.1mm) bolt pattern.
